This is Warren's revision of the novel in preparation for Blackwood's edition, 1841. Vol. 1 autograph manuscript of Parts VII-XIII, XIX-XXI with 5 loose leaves of autograph memoranda and drafts for Part I. Vols. 2-4 contain printed leaves with autograph annotations and revisions. The printed leaves were cut from Blackwood's Edinburgh magazine (1839-1841) vols. 9-13, and tipped into these volumes.…

Presumed Innocent
The novel that launched Turow's career as one of America's pre-eminent thriller writers tells the story of Rusty Sabicch, chief deputy prosecutor in a large Midwestern city. With three weeks to go in his boss' re-election campaign, a member of Rusty's staff is found murdered; he is charged with finding the killer, until his boss loses and, incredibly, Rusty finds himself accused of the murder.

A Dog's Purpose
A Dog's Purpose is a 2010 novel written by American author W. Bruce Cameron. It chronicles a dog's journey through four lives via reincarnation and how he looks for his purpose through each.
